Lesson 56: Unit Review
Teaching Content:
Mastery words and expressions from Lesson49 to Lesson56.
Oral words and expressions from Lesson49 to Lesson56.
Teaching Aims:
1. How to express one’s hobby in English correctly.
2. The same and different hobbies in China and western countries.
Teaching Important Points:
1. Talk about likes and dislikes.
2. Talk about sequences.
Teaching Difficult Points:
Verb-ing
Teaching Preparation: flashcards
Teaching Aids: audiotape; flashcards
Type of lesson: review lesson
Teaching Procedure:
Step1. Show the pictures of Danny’s hobby to the class. Let the students talk in groups about Danny’s hobby. Do the students appreciate his hobby
Step2. Have a further discussion about Paul’s hobby. Do you think Paul’s hobby easy or difficult Can you make it by yourself What do you think it is made of Do you think it is safe What do you think it is used be
Step3. Let the students show their hobbies in class again. Are their collections much richer than before after we learn this unit Exchange their ideas about each other’s hobby. Some ideas must be very useful. The others sometimes provide what they need.
Step4. Do the exercises on Page 69 and 70. When the students check the answers, the teacher tours in the classroom and help them if necessary. Find the problems and discuss them with the whole class.

Summary:
We are in Grade Two now. All the students may think they know a little English. Sometimes they get their knowledge from the TV, radio and computers. Let them present what they learn out of the class, give them a chance to present. Sum the new words and expressions and write them on the blackboard. Let all the students learn together. Thus the students’ interests of learning English will be improved. Encourage them to sing foreign songs.
